Frequently Asked Questions

Is Nashville cheaper than Geneva?

Geneva is cheaper than Nashville. Geneva has a cost of living index of 49/100 compared to 56/100 for Nashville (New York = 100), making it roughly 13% more affordable overall.

How much cheaper is Geneva than Nashville?

Geneva is approximately 13% cheaper than Nashville based on cost index scores (49 vs 56, where New York = 100). A person spending $3,000/month in Nashville could live a similar lifestyle for roughly $2,614/month in Geneva.

What is the rent comparison between Nashville and Geneva?

In Nashville, a 1-bedroom apartment in the city center costs approximately $1,690/month. In Geneva, the equivalent is around $2,890/month.

Which city is better for digital nomads — Nashville or Geneva?

Both cities have nomad infrastructure. Nashville offers 90 Mbps internet and coworking at ~$200/month. Geneva offers 450 Mbps and coworking at ~$325/month. Geneva has a cost advantage of 13%.

What is the average income in Nashville vs Geneva?

The median net monthly salary in Nashville is approximately $4,368 USD, compared to $9,250 USD in Geneva.
